Construction of Microarrays for E. coli 0157:H7

Objective

The objectives of this cooperative research project are to construct gene microarrays for E. coli O157:H7 strain EDL933. These microarrays will be used to identify differences in gene expression of E. coli O157:H7 that are grown or exposed to different environmental conditions both in vivo and in vitro. E. coli O157:H7 genes that are preferentially expressed in vivo will be candidates for further evaluation to determine their specific role in colonization, survival, and persistence in cattle.

More information

The published genomic sequence of E. coli O157:H7 will be used to design primers for PCR amplification of the 3574 open reading frame (ORFs) that are common to both O157 and K-12 strains, the 1387 O157 unique ORFs, the 528 K-12 unique ORFs, and the 100 genes that are carried on the pO157 plasmid present in O157:H7 E. coli. The PCR products will be spotted in a microarray and used in hybridization assays. RNA isolated from O157:H7 E. coli grown or exposed to different in vivo and in vitro conditions will be used to produce labeled cDNA for hybridization. This will be used to identify genes that are differentially expressed under a variety of different conditions both in vitro and in vivo.
